      Tell me about dealing with my anger

      I've been repressing my anger for years and now for the past few months when someone gives me a reason to be angry I do nothing when I should Do something. naturally I'm a calm and quiet person and lately I've been feeling like I'm being pushed to the limit to not get angry it maybe because Im afraid of the consequences can someone help me with dealing with this rage I'm feeling

      I personally think that is probably a good thing. You don't really want to act out in anger, that just causes all sort of problems. It is far better that you remain calm, consider things rationally then do what needs to be done. Don't feel like you need to address things on the spot. If something really upsets you, it is okay to resolve it later. If you are still upset about something long after it happen, it is probably because you never resolved it.
